Directions

- Preheat your campfire coals, grill, or oven to about 350–400°F.
- Cut large rectangles of heavy-duty foil (about 8×12 inches each).
- Toss sliced apples with sugars and cinnamon in a bowl.
- In a separate bowl, combine flour, oats, brown sugar, and melted butter to form a crumbly topping.
- Divide the apple mixture among foil sheets. Top each with a scoop of oat topping.
- Fold and seal foil packets tightly.
- Cook for 15–30 minutes on hot coals, grill, or oven rack until apples are tender and topping is golden.
- Carefully open packets and top with ice cream or caramel sauce if desired.

FAQs
What apples are best for foil packet crisps?
Use firm, tart apples like Granny Smith or Honeycrisp for the best texture and flavor.
Can I make this recipe in the oven?
Yes, bake at 400°F for about 15–20 minutes on a baking sheet.
How do I keep the topping crispy?
Cook directly over heat and open the packets slightly toward the end of cooking if needed.
Can I prep this ahead?
Yes, assemble the foil packets and store in the fridge or freezer until ready to cook.
Are these packets safe over a fire?
Yes, just use heavy-duty foil or double wrap to prevent burning.
Can I add nuts?
Absolutely—chopped pecans or walnuts add great texture.
What if I don’t have quick oats?
Rolled oats work fine, though the topping will be slightly chewier.
How do I serve them?
Serve directly in the foil packet or transfer to a bowl with a scoop of ice cream.
Are they gluten-free?
Use a gluten-free flour blend and certified gluten-free oats.
Can I make these vegan?
Yes, use plant-based butter and ensure your sugars are vegan.

Ingredients
For the apple filling:
-
4 medium apples, peeled, cored, and sliced thin
-
2 tablespoons brown sugar
-
1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
-
1 tablespoon lemon juice
For the crumble topping:
-
1/2 cup rolled oats
-
1/3 cup all-purpose flour
-
1/4 cup brown sugar
-
1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
-
1/4 cup cold unsalted butter, diced
-
Pinch of salt
Instructions
-
Preheat your grill or campfire to medium heat.
-
In a large bowl, toss sliced apples with brown sugar, cinnamon, and lemon juice.
-
In another bowl, mix oats, flour, brown sugar, cinnamon, and salt. Add diced butter and mix until crumbly.
-
Tear off 4 large sheets of heavy-duty aluminum foil. Divide the apple mixture evenly among the packets.
-
Sprinkle the crumble topping over the apples.
-
Fold the foil to seal the packets tightly.
-
Place the packets over the campfire or grill and cook for 15–20 minutes, turning halfway through.
-
Carefully open packets (watch for steam) and serve warm. Optional: top with a scoop of vanilla ice cream.
Notes
-
Use firm apples like Granny Smith or Honeycrisp for best results.
-
These can also be baked in a 375°F oven for about 20 minutes.
-
Double-wrap the foil for extra protection on open flames.
